Twenty-nine scholars author this book to review the development of political science in Taiwan. It is the third comprehensive review of the various subfields in the discipline in the fine tradition of its precursors published in 2000 and 2013. The book contains 22 chapters that fall into six categories: political theory and methodology, comparative politics, international and cross-Strait relations, public administration, Taiwan politics, and politics of China. Building upon the research of Taiwanese scholars and carrying on the spirit of the previous two publications, this book not only reviews the development of the discipline but also explores the current situation of the discipline as a whole and points out possible development in the future. It is a retrospect and prospect for Taiwan’s political science academic community.

With its accessible approach, this book provides readers with a comprehensive understanding of contemporary political science in Taiwan.
